Lucy Quatermaine has reported a substantial increase in sales via their website during lockdown and this year’s second quarter. 

The award-winning jewellery designer, based in Cheshire, saw a 70% increase in sales per month compared to the previous year.

Quartermaine saw the largest sales increase of 77% in June, which coincided with the launch of their new website and its improved mobile user platform.

Sales in earrings, bracelets and anklets increased over the summer months, with the designer’s Drop and Teardrop collections also selling well.

Quartermaine said: ‘‘I was overwhelmed by the sales increase we have seen during lockdown, during such an uncertain time it is amazing to see so many brand ambassadors of our designs continue to build on their own collections.’’
